Triumph Daytona 675 / R (2013-2018)
“R” version has better suspension and brakes, higher seat.
Updated: 22 January 2026
Specifications and Features
| Length | 2045 mm |
|---|---|
| Width | 695 mm (handlebars) |
| Height | 1112 mm |
| Seat Height | 820 mm (R: 830) |
| Weight | – 184 kg wet |
| Engine | 675 cc Inline-3, liquid-cooled |
| Power | 126 hp @ 12600 rpm |
| Power to weight ratio | 69 HP/100kg |
| Torque | 74 Nm @ 11900 rpm |
| Torque to weight ratio | 40 Nm/100kg |
| Transmission | – 6-speed, wet multi-plate slip/assist clutch |
| Fuel Capacity | 17,5 litres |
| Suspension | – Front: 43 mm inverted fork, fully adjustable, 120 mm travel (R: 110 mm) |
| Tyres | – Front: 120/70-17 (-43 cm) |
| Brakes | – Front: 308 mm discs, monobloc 4-piston calipers |
| Instruments | – Analogue tachometer, LCD display with speedometer, odometer, gear indicator, fuel gauge, dual trip meters, clock, lap timer, programmable shift-up indicator |
| Other | – LED taillight |
